  1. Which one of the following methods of soil conservation is most effective in arid areas?
    1. Mulching
    2. Shelter belt
    3. Gully plugging`
    4. Terracing
Correct Option: B

The shelter belt method of soil conservation is most effective in arid areas. A shelterbelt is a barrier of trees or shrubs. The term "field shelterbelt" is used to distinguish between rows of trees or shrubs on agricultural fields from those planted in other ways: around farmyards or livestock facilities (farmstead shelterbelts). It controls soil erosion and traps the moisture which is necessary to grow crop in such regions.
